Harassment in the Workplace for California Managers

Provider: CeriFi Checkpoint Learning

Business Law 2 CPE Credits Overview QAS self study
This course is required for all California supervisors who work for organizations with five or more employees. It explains what supervisors and managers in California should do to avoid or minimize incidents of discrimination and harassment. It is recommended as a training tool to reduce the risk of legal liability that supervisors and managers face for violations of federal, state, and local workplace discrimination and harassment laws. This course satisfies the sexual harassment training requirements for California.
